Explanation:

Given set is:

A = {a,b,c,d}

What is the cardinality of A?

The cardinality of set is the number of elements in the set

Since, set A has four members the cardinality is 4.

i.e.

n(A) = 4

What is the power set of ℘(A)?

The power set of a set consists of all the subsets of a set.

So the power set of A will consist of all subsets of A.

The power set is:

P(A) = {Ф, {a}, {b}, {c}, {d}, {a,b}, {a,c}, {a,d}, {b,c}, {b,d}, {c,d}, {a,b,c}, {a,b,d}, {b,c,d}, {a,c,d},{a,b,c,d}}

What is the cardinality of the power set?

The number of subsets of a set is the cardinality of power set.

As A is 4 members,

Cardinality of Power set of A = 2^4 = 16

What is the power set of A = { }

As A is an empty set, its power set will have only one element (Ф) as member

P(A) = {{ }} or {Ф}
